This is a very dry fall, and sadly, while much of the area isn’t heavily in a drought anymore, a large swathe still hasn’t recovered. In the coming days, with a dry October being on the menu, this is only expected to worsen.
Regions of Douglas and Ozark Counties have increased to the beginning stages of a drought, with area further west worsening to a D3, or “extreme” conditions.
